E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
斯坦纳树
bzoj3205: [Apio2013]机器人
id=3205思路:类似
斯坦纳树
的想法但是因为这里的合并必须连号所以子集枚举就变成了区间合并说说做法好了首先记搜搜出每个点向四个方向走一步会到哪里注意:转向器可能导致机器人一直在里面转出不来,要特判掉然后设
thy_asdf
·
2016-05-08 20:00
bzoj4006: [JLOI2015]管道连接
id=4006思路:一眼看上去很像
斯坦纳树
但是限制稍有不同,只要每种颜色的点联通即可也就是说最后可能是森林我听说裸写
斯坦纳树
有90所以我们要在外面再套一层DPf[i][j]还是
斯坦纳树
的状态,i是以i为根
thy_asdf
·
2016-05-08 19:00
bzoj2595: [Wc2008]游览计划
id=2595思路:
斯坦纳树
斯坦纳树
问题就是给你n个点的图,点或边上有权值,有k个点是关键点求使k个关键点联通且权值和最小的方案我们知道最后的结果一定是一棵树DP状态就是f[i][j]表示以i为根,关键点联通性为
thy_asdf
·
2016-05-08 19:00
bzoj3205 机器人
斯坦纳树
这道题目应该是比较明显的
斯坦纳树
吧。
lych_cys
·
2016-03-28 19:00
动态规划
SPFA
斯坦纳树
HDU 3311 Dig The Wells(
斯坦纳树
)
【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=3311 【题意】 给定k座庙,n个其他点,m条边,点权代表挖井费用,边权代表连边费用,问使得k座庙里的所有和尚都能吃到水的最小费用。 【思路】 首先一个相连的块里只要有口井就能保证块里的和尚有水。所以这个题目标并不是要让k个点连通,但我们可以转化一下。 在原图的基础上我们添加
hahalidaxin
·
2016-03-21 14:00
bzoj 4006 [JLOI2015]管道连接(
斯坦纳树
+状压DP)
【题目链接】 http://www.lydsy.com/JudgeOnline/problem.php?id=4006 【题意】 给定n点m边的图,连接边(u,v)需要花费w,问将k个点中同颜色的点连接的最小费用。 【思路】 题目所求斯坦纳森林。 如果我们知道满足颜色集合S的最小值g[S],则有递推公式: g[S]=min{g[S’]+g[S-S’]} 则g
hahalidaxin
·
2016-03-21 11:00
bzoj 2595 [Wc2008]游览计划(
斯坦纳树
)
【科普】 “
斯坦纳树
”就是包含给定点的最小生成树。 【思路】 那么本题就是求一棵
斯坦纳树
。 设f[i][j][S]表示在点(i,j)且与之相连的点的状态为S。 有两种转移:
hahalidaxin
·
2016-03-20 21:00
【HDU4085】Peach Blossom Spring【
斯坦纳树
】【状态压缩】
pid=4085裸的
斯坦纳树
。
BraketBN
·
2016-03-14 16:00
bzoj4006 管道连接 斯坦纳森林 子集Dp
233),然后我们就需要求出所有频道属于某一个集合的
斯坦纳树
,最后用子集Dp把所有的
斯坦纳树
合成一个森林。
lych_cys
·
2016-03-09 08:00
状压dp
斯坦纳树
子集Dp
HDU 4085 Peach Blossom Spring(
斯坦纳树
+dp)
后来一看才知道原来是
斯坦纳树
。。。。如此高级的东西。
斯坦纳树
的定义:
斯坦纳树
问题是组合优化问题,与最小生成树相似,是最短网络的一种。最小生成树是在给定的点集和边中寻求最短网络使所有点连通。而最
只玩三国的程序猿
·
2016-03-08 23:08
图论
动态规划
bzoj2595 游览计划
斯坦纳树
&状压Dp
一直不知道
斯坦纳树
是什么东西。。。(搞得我现在完全知道了一样)。大概就是求一棵树连接一些带权点使某个总和最小吧。(就是一个理论模型而已不是什么算法?)
lych_cys
·
2016-03-08 09:00
最短路
SPFA
状压dp
斯坦纳树
图论模型总结(已做过并且有一定了解)
最短路模型差分约束模型最小生成树最大二分匹配二分完美匹配稳定婚姻问题最大权闭包最小点权覆盖最小割最大流
斯坦纳树
2-SAT舞蹈链+精确覆盖
只玩三国的程序猿
·
2016-03-04 19:35
个人总结
BZOJ 4006: [JLOI2015]管道连接|
斯坦纳树
斯坦纳树
似乎是带有关键点的最小生成树暴力状压,然后还有染色,似乎要再套一个状压#include #include #include #include #include #include #include
ws_yzy
·
2016-01-19 14:00
斯坦纳树
hdu 3311
斯坦纳树
然后就是求
斯坦纳树
了。
·
2015-11-13 00:54
HDU
hdu 4085
斯坦纳树
思路: 这里必须要选择的点是2*k个,首先就是求一边
斯坦纳树
,然后做一次动态规划出每个状态下的最小值。
·
2015-11-13 00:54
HDU
[原]花样作死记录文~
2112 HDU Today基础最短路★ 1874 畅通工程续基础最短路★ 3832 Earth Hour三点连通(
斯坦纳树
·
2015-11-12 22:17
记录
BZOJ1401 : Hexagon
这题显然是一个最小
斯坦纳树
的模型,直接上模板即可,就是正六边形比较恶心。
·
2015-10-31 16:06
ZOJ
CF 152E Garden
CF_152E 这个题目只需要求一棵
斯坦纳树
,但是蛋疼的是需要打印路径,因此要多开一个数组记录路径。
·
2015-10-24 09:30
c
HDU 4085 Peach Blossom Spring
HDU_4085 去年去北京时用网络流死磕这题导致了全场悲剧,今年再做依旧毫无头绪,找到题解一看瞬间震惊了,
斯坦纳树
(Stenier tree)是什么东东(不过后来发现其实解法就是个状态压缩
·
2015-10-24 09:27
spring
hdu4085 Peach Blossom Spring
斯坦纳树
,状态dp
[ss], dp[i][rr | s[i]] + dp[i][(ss ^ rr) | s[i]]);,后面的要 |s[i],保证状态的正确 (3)INF初始化CLR(dp, 0x3f) (4)注意
斯坦纳树
状态理解
·
2015-10-23 09:47
spring
【模板】
斯坦纳树
includeintmain(){puts("转载请注明出处[辗转山河弋流歌by空灰冰魂]谢谢");puts("网址:blog.csdn.net/vmurder/article/details/46499973");}题目:
斯坦纳树
空灰冰魂
·
2015-06-15 09:50
模板
斯坦纳树
【模板】
斯坦纳树
{ puts("转载请注明出处[辗转山河弋流歌by空灰冰魂]谢谢"); puts("网址:blog.csdn.net/vmurder/article/details/46499973"); }题目:
斯坦纳树
Vmurder
·
2015-06-15 09:00
模板
斯坦纳树
【自用】OI计划安排表一轮
二分答案分数规划√贪心动态规划斜率优化√数位DP√概率DP√插头DP图论差分约束√floyd求最小环√连通分量相关√强连通分量√点双连通分量√边双连通分量√割点√割边√最小生成树√Matrix-Tree定理√
斯坦纳树
Vmurder
·
2015-06-11 11:00
计划
OI
自用
BZOJ4006【
斯坦纳树
】
/*Iwillwaitforyou*/ #include #include #include #include #include #include #include #include #include #include #include #include #include #include #definemake(a,b)make_pair(a,b) #definefifirst #define
Lethelody
·
2015-05-04 02:00
【
斯坦纳树
】 HDOJ 3311 Dig The Wells
解题思路:DP过程增加一维,代表能不能喝到水,做一边
斯坦纳树
,然后再做一边DP。
blankcqk
·
2015-02-10 20:00
hdoj
斯坦纳树
【
斯坦纳树
】 HDOJ 4085 Peach Blossom Spring
斯坦纳树
参见:http://endlesscount.blog.163.com/blog/static/821197872012525113427573#include #include #include
blankcqk
·
2015-02-10 15:00
hdoj
【BZOJ2595】【Wc2008】游览计划、
斯坦纳树
题解:
斯坦纳树
,实现神马的在代码里面有还看得过去的注释。
Vmurder
·
2015-01-09 18:00
斯坦纳树
WC2008
BZOJ2595
游览计划
BZOJ 3205 Apio2013 机器人
斯坦纳树
题目大意:给定一张地图,一些地方有障碍物,有k(i,j))f[l][r][i][j]=min(f[l][temp][i][j]+f[temp+1][r][i][j])(l #include #include #include #include #defineM510 #defineINF0x3f3f3f3f usingnamespacestd; typedefpairabcd; templatec
PoPoQQQ
·
2015-01-08 15:00
bzoj
斯坦纳树
BZOJ3205
BZOJ 2595 Wc2008 游览计划
斯坦纳树
题目大意:给定一个矩阵,有一些关键点,每个格子有权值,选择一些格子使所有关键点连通,求最小权值和传说中的
斯坦纳树
--感觉不是很难理解的样子枚举连通的状态,对于每个状态先对每个位置枚举子集进行合并,然后对这个状态的分层图进行
PoPoQQQ
·
2015-01-08 10:00
bzoj
斯坦纳树
BZOJ2595
BZOJ 2595 WC 2008 游览计划
斯坦纳树
思路:
斯坦纳树
,大概意思就是将k个点连接起来的最小生成树。由于是NP完全问题,只能通过状压什么的解决。设f[i][j][s]为根为(i,j)时景点的联通情况为s的最小生成树权值和。
jiangyuze831
·
2015-01-04 18:00
最小生成树
bzoj
斯坦纳树
WC2008
【BZOJ】【P2595】【Wc2008】【游览计划】【题解】【
斯坦纳树
】
传送门:http://www.lydsy.com/JudgeOnline/problem.php?id=2595推荐看姜碧野的《SPFA的优化与应用》以及 http://www.cnblogs.com/lazycal/archive/2013/08/31/bzoj-2595.html等学会了插头dp再换个姿势写一个Code:#include #definefstfirst #definesecse
u012732945
·
2014-12-19 17:00
bzoj
斯坦纳树
斯坦纳树
是一类比较特殊的DP吧,主要针对点集连通问题,通常dp[i][s]表示以i为根的,连通状态为s的一棵树的最小权值,有两种转移方式,其中state[i]表示点i的二进制标号,通常无关的点state
·
2014-07-15 23:00
树
zoj 3613 Wormhole Transport (
斯坦纳树
)
思路:有工厂和资源的星球很少,所以这题可以用状压解决,由于最终结果可能是森林,求完
斯坦纳树
后要合并,合并前后的每个状态都要满足工厂数大于等于资源数才能合并。
qian99
·
2014-04-03 16:00
dp
Graph
hdu 3311 Dig The Wells (SteinerTree
斯坦纳树
)
ProblemDescriptionYoumayallknowthefamousstory“Threemonks”.Recentlytheyfindsomeplacesaroundtheirtemplescanbeenusedtodigsomewells.Itwillhelpthemsavealotoftime.Buttodigthewellorbuildtheroadtotransportthe
lphy2352286B
·
2014-03-05 22:00
hdu 4085
斯坦纳树
#include #include #include usingnamespacestd; constintmaxm=11e2+9,maxn=10e1+9; intdp[maxm][maxn],num[maxn],d[maxn][maxn]; intn,m,k; boolvisit[maxn],chk[maxm]; voidgetdp() { memset(dp,50,sizeof(dp)); m
yrleep
·
2013-11-25 16:00
亚洲赛前训练计划
图论方面: 1.dfs,bfs 2.强连通,点双连通,边双连通,2-sat 3.匈牙利算法km,以及不等式解 4.网络流,费用流 5.最短路,SPFA,dijstra,floay,
斯坦纳树
nealgavin
·
2013-10-09 14:00
UVALive 5717 Peach Blossom Spring(
斯坦纳树
STNT)
如果大家对
斯坦纳树
不是很了解的,可以参看这里:http://endlesscount.blog.163.com/blog/static/821197872012525113427573/这道题目还有点不一样
u010794465
·
2013-09-09 19:00
Hdu 3311 Dig The Wells (综合_
斯坦纳树
)
Zoj3613WormholeTransport(综合_
斯坦纳树
)分类: 全部博客 ACM_动态规划(DP) ACM_数据结构 ACM_图论系列2012-09-0500:16 462人阅读 评论(0)
pi9nc
·
2013-08-14 21:00
ACM_数据结构
ACM_数据结构
ACM_动态规划(DP)
ACM_图论系列
全部博客
全部博客
ACM_动态规划(DP)
ACM_图论系列
斯坦纳树
问题及其推广
斯坦纳树
问题及其推广分类: 数学2009-07-1223:03 710人阅读 评论(0) 收藏 举报算法网络终端优化工作图形
斯坦纳树
问题是组合优化学科中的一个问题。
pi9nc
·
2013-07-27 21:00
数学
ZOJ 3613 Wormhole Transport
无奈算法能力太弱,搜了解题报告后才知道有
斯坦纳树
这东西。学了一下,终于会做了。
gzh1992n
·
2013-06-18 21:00
ZOJ
斯坦纳树
Steiner Tree
不久前学习了
斯坦纳树
,今天决定记录下。以便日后忘了,好回忆起来。1.什么是
斯坦纳树
?
斯坦纳树
问题是组合优化学科中的一个问题。
gzh1992n
·
2013-06-18 21:00
tree
模版
Steiner
斯坦纳树
斯坦纳树
hdu4085
//
斯坦纳树
//hdu4085 /*复杂度:O(n^2*2^k+n*3^k) 枚举子树的形态:f[i][j]=min{f[i][j],f[k][j]+f[l][j]},其中k和l是对i的一个划分。
longshuai0821
·
2012-10-28 19:00
ZOJ 3613 Wormhole Transport(DP
斯坦纳树
)
还是
斯坦纳树
,不懂看:http://endlesscount.blog.163.com/blog/static/821197872012525113427573/#include #include #
shiqi_614
·
2012-10-21 22:00
工作
struct
UP
HDU 4085 Peach Blossom Spring(DP,
斯坦纳树
)
同样是
斯坦纳树
,不过最后得到的答案可能是森林,所以最后要跑一个DP。
shiqi_614
·
2012-10-21 21:00
spring
struct
CF 108E Garden(DP,
斯坦纳树
)
简单的
斯坦纳树
,只要要要多开一个数组记录路径。
shiqi_614
·
2012-10-21 21:00
ini
ZOJ 3613
斯坦纳树
#include #include #include #defineN210 #defineM5100 usingnamespacestd; inta[N],b[N]; inta1[N],b1[
waitfor_
·
2012-09-27 21:00
Hdu 3311 Dig The Wells (综合_
斯坦纳树
)
解题思路: 因为必须覆盖n个和尚,那么便是求一颗包含前n个点的
斯坦纳树
。 一开始我的做法是将
woshi250hua
·
2012-09-08 23:00
Zoj 3613 Wormhole Transport (综合_
斯坦纳树
)
题目链接: http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emCode=3613题目大意:给定一张图有n个顶点,某些点有工厂,某些点有资源,每个资源可以供应给一个工厂,有m条无向边,边有边权。已知有资源的点不超过4个,有工厂的点也不超过4个,问选择若干条边如何使有资源工厂的工厂最多,当数量一样多时输出最小权值。n #include #i
woshi250hua
·
2012-09-05 00:00
c
struct
tree
null
input
output
Hdu 4085 Peach Blossom Spring (综合_
斯坦纳树
)
解题思路:11年北京现场赛的题目,经典的
斯坦纳树
。
斯坦纳树
简称STN
woshi250hua
·
2012-09-05 00:00
斯坦纳树
问题及其推广
斯坦纳树
问题是组合优化学科中的一个问题。 组合优化学科包含许许多多的问题,它们都来源于生活,是许多实际问题的某种抽象。
lyg_wangyushi
·
2009-07-12 23:00
算法
工作
优化
网络
图形
终端
上一页
1
2
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他